Binær Kode Alfabet: En Grundig Forklaring
Introduktion til Binær Kode Alfabet
Binær kode alfabet er en metode til at repræsentere og behandle information ved hjælp af to symboler, normalt repræsenteret som 0 og 1. Dette alfabet er grundlæggende for moderne datalogi og elektronisk kommunikation. I denne artikel vil vi udforske, hvad binær kode alfabet er, hvordan det fungerer, dets historie, fordele og ulemper, anvendelse, eksempler, implementering, sikkerhed og konklusion.
Hvad er binær kode alfabet?
Binær kode alfabet er en måde at repræsentere data på ved hjælp af to symboler, normalt 0 og 1. Disse symboler kaldes bits, og de er grundlæggende enheder i binær kode alfabet. Hvert bit kan være enten tændt (1) eller slukket (0), hvilket repræsenterer forskellige tilstande eller værdier.
Hvordan fungerer binær kode alfabet?
I binær kode alfabet repræsenteres information ved hjælp af en sekvens af bits. Disse bits kan kombineres for at danne større enheder af information, såsom tegn, tal eller endda billeder og lyd. For eksempel kan et enkelt tegn i et binært kode alfabet repræsenteres ved hjælp af en sekvens af bits, hvor hvert bit repræsenterer en bestemt del af tegnet.
Historien bag Binær Kode Alfabet
Udviklingen af binær kode alfabet
Binær kode alfabet har rødder tilbage til det 17. århundrede, hvor den tyske matematiker og filosof Gottfried Wilhelm Leibniz udviklede det binære talsystem. Dette talsystem var baseret på princippet om brugen af kun to symboler, 0 og 1, til at repræsentere tal. Senere blev dette koncept udvidet til at omfatte repræsentationen af andre former for information.
Anvendelse af binær kode alfabet i datalogi
I det 20. århundrede blev binær kode alfabet en central del af datalogi og elektronisk kommunikation. Med opkomsten af computere og digitale systemer blev binær kode alfabet den foretrukne metode til at repræsentere og behandle information. Det blev grundlaget for udviklingen af programmeringssprog, operativsystemer og andre teknologier.
Fordele og Ulemper ved Binær Kode Alfabet
Fordele ved binær kode alfabet
Binær kode alfabet har flere fordele, herunder:
- Enkelhed: Binær kode alfabet er en enkel metode til at repræsentere og behandle information. Det bruger kun to symboler, hvilket gør det nemt at implementere og forstå.
- Effektivitet: Binær kode alfabet er effektivt i forhold til lagerplads og behandlingstid. Da det kun bruger to symboler, kan det repræsentere og behandle store mængder information på en kompakt måde.
- Pålidelighed: Binær kode alfabet er en pålidelig metode til at overføre og gemme information. Det er mindre modtageligt for støj og forvrængning sammenlignet med andre metoder.
Ulemper ved binær kode alfabet
Der er også nogle ulemper ved binær kode alfabet, herunder:
- Kompleksitet: Selvom binær kode alfabet er en enkel metode i sin grundlæggende form, kan det blive komplekst, når det bruges til at repræsentere komplekse datastrukturer eller udføre avancerede beregninger.
- Størrelse: Binær kode alfabet kan producere store mængder data, især når det bruges til at repræsentere store mængder information. Dette kan kræve mere lagerplads og båndbredde.
- Fejlhåndtering: Binær kode alfabet kan være sårbart over for fejl og forvrængning under overførsel eller lagring af data. Derfor er der behov for mekanismer til fejlfinding og korrektion.
Anvendelse af Binær Kode Alfabet
Binær kode alfabet i elektroniske enheder
Binær kode alfabet er afgørende for driften af elektroniske enheder som computere, smartphones, tablets og andre elektroniske enheder. Det bruges til at repræsentere og behandle information internt i disse enheder, såsom instruktioner til processorer, lagring af data og kommunikation mellem enheder.
Binær kode alfabet i kommunikationssystemer
Binær kode alfabet spiller også en vigtig rolle i kommunikationssystemer som internettet og mobilnetværk. Det bruges til at overføre og modtage data mellem forskellige enheder og netværk. Det muliggør pålidelig og effektiv kommunikation ved at repræsentere data i en form, der kan transmitteres og modtages af forskellige enheder.
Eksempler på Binær Kode Alfabet
ASCII-kode
ASCII (American Standard Code for Information Interchange) er et eksempel på et binært kode alfabet, der bruges til at repræsentere tegn og symboler i det engelske sprog. Hvert tegn i ASCII-koden er repræsenteret ved hjælp af en sekvens af 8 bits, hvilket giver mulighed for repræsentation af op til 256 forskellige tegn.
Unicode-kode
Unicode er et mere omfattende binært kode alfabet, der bruges til at repræsentere tegn og symboler fra forskellige sprog og skriftsystemer over hele verden. Det understøtter en bred vifte af tegn og symboler og bruger forskellige kodningsformer, herunder 8-bit, 16-bit og 32-bit, afhængigt af behovet for tegnrepræsentation.
Implementering af Binær Kode Alfabet
Programmeringssprog og binær kode alfabet
Programmeringssprog som C, C++, Java og Python bruger binær kode alfabet til at repræsentere og behandle data. Disse sprog giver indbyggede funktioner og biblioteker til at arbejde med binær kode alfabet, herunder konvertering mellem binær kode og andre repræsentationsformer.
Fejlfinding og korrektion i binær kode alfabet
Fejlfinding og korrektion er vigtige aspekter af binær kode alfabet. Da binær kode alfabet kan være sårbart over for fejl og forvrængning, er der behov for mekanismer til at opdage og rette fejl. Dette kan omfatte brugen af fejlkorrektionskoder, redundans og andre teknikker.
Binær Kode Alfabet og Sikkerhed
Kryptering og dekryptering af binær kode alfabet
Binær kode alfabet spiller en vigtig rolle i kryptering og dekryptering af data. Kryptering er processen med at konvertere data til en form, der ikke kan læses af uautoriserede parter, mens dekryptering er processen med at konvertere krypteret data tilbage til sin oprindelige form. Binær kode alfabet bruges til at repræsentere og behandle data under disse processer.
Sikkerhedstrusler og beskyttelse i binær kode alfabet
Binær kode alfabet kan være sårbart over for forskellige sikkerhedstrusler, såsom hacking, malware og datatab. Derfor er der behov for forskellige sikkerhedsforanstaltninger for at beskytte data i binær kode alfabet, herunder adgangskontrol, kryptering, sikkerhedskopiering og overvågning.
Konklusion
Opsummering af binær kode alfabet
Binær kode alfabet er en grundlæggende metode til at repræsentere og behandle information ved hjælp af to symboler, normalt 0 og 1. Det er afgørende for moderne datalogi og elektronisk kommunikation. Binær kode alfabet har flere fordele, herunder enkelhed, effektivitet og pålidelighed, men det har også nogle ulemper, såsom kompleksitet, størrelse og fejlhåndtering. Det anvendes i elektroniske enheder og kommunikationssystemer, og det findes i eksempler som ASCII-kode og Unicode-kode. Implementering af binær kode alfabet involverer brug af programmeringssprog og mekanismer til fejlfinding og korrektion. Det spiller også en vigtig rolle i sikkerhed og beskyttelse af data.
Vigtigheden af binær kode alfabet i moderne teknologi
Binær kode alfabet er afgørende for moderne teknologi og spiller en afgørende rolle i alle aspekter af datalogi og elektronisk kommunikation. Uden binær kode alfabet ville vi ikke have computere, smartphones, internettet eller andre teknologier, vi bruger i dag. Det er grundlaget for vores digitale verden og en nøglekomponent i vores moderne livsstil.